Grain Bin Sales: Key Steps to Optimize Management and Enhance Efficiency
In the modern agricultural supply chain, grain bin serve as crucial nodes for grain storage and sales, with their operational efficiency and sales strategies directly affecting the stability and development of the entire grain market. Grain bin sales not only relate to the secure storage of grain but also impact farmers’ incomes, market supply and demand balance, and consumer interests. Therefore, optimizing grain bin sales management and enhancing sales efficiency have become urgent issues in the agricultural sector.
I. Ensure Grain Quality and Safety to Establish a Solid Sales Foundation
The primary task of grain bin sales is to ensure the quality and safety of grain. As a special commodity, grain quality directly affects people’s health and safety. Grain bins must strictly adhere to national grain quality standards throughout the processes of purchasing, storing, and selling. By utilizing modern detection methods and technologies, grain bins can ensure that every grain meets the established standards and requirements. Additionally, grain bins should enhance management practices for pest control, moisture prevention, and mold prevention to maintain the stability of grain quality during storage. Only by ensuring the quality and safety of grain can a solid foundation be laid for subsequent sales efforts.
II. Flexibly Adjust Sales Strategies to Meet Market Demand
In terms of sales strategies, grain bins need to flexibly adjust their approaches based on market dynamics and consumer demand. On one hand, grain bins should actively establish stable partnerships with grain processing companies, wholesalers, and retailers by signing long-term supply contracts and offering favorable policies to stabilize sales channels and expand market share. On the other hand, grain bins must pay attention to changes in consumer preferences and timely introduce new varieties and packaging that align with consumer tastes and health needs to enhance the market competitiveness of grain products. By flexibly adjusting sales strategies, grain bins can better adapt to market changes and meet consumer demands.
III. Strengthen Information Technology to Enhance Sales Management Efficiency
To improve the effectiveness of grain bin sales, it is essential to strengthen the information technology infrastructure. By implementing modern information management systems, grain bins can achieve real-time monitoring and management of all processes, including grain entry, exit, inventory, and sales, thereby increasing work efficiency and reducing human errors. Additionally, information technology can help grain bins analyze market dynamics more effectively, forecast future trends, and provide strong support for developing scientific and rational sales strategies. With improved information systems, grain bins can more accurately grasp sales conditions, promptly adjust sales strategies, and enhance management efficiency.
IV. Government Guidance and Support to Boost Grain Bin Sales
The government’s role in grain bin sales is also significant. Governments can formulate relevant policies to guide and support the sales efforts of grain bins. For instance, the government can provide financial subsidies to encourage grain bins to purchase more grain, ensuring food security. Furthermore, the government can increase support for grain processing companies to promote deep processing and refinement in the grain industry, enhancing the added value and market competitiveness of grain products. Government guidance and support can provide more policy assurance and market opportunities for grain bin sales.
V. Expand New Sales Channels to Broaden Market Reach
Additionally, grain bins can leverage new sales channels such as e-commerce platforms to expand their market reach. Through e-commerce platforms, grain bins can establish direct connections with consumers, understand their needs and feedback, and offer more personalized products and services. E-commerce platforms also enable grain bins to overcome geographical limitations and sell grain products in broader markets. By expanding new sales channels, grain bins can further widen their sales markets and enhance sales performance.
